98 Accord V3.0, Re-Starting after Driving Problems
#1
98 Accord V3.0, Re-Starting after Driving Problems
Car: 98 Accord Ex 2-Dr V-Tech 3.0, 160k,
Problem: Intermittant re-Starting problem, only after after driving
Occurs maybe 5-10% of the time when tried restarting
Starter Cranks fine, turns engine fast, no warning lights, full tanks to 1/4
Background:
Owned for 1.5 years and started noticing problem last summaer (9 months ago)
Starts 1st Time after Over-night sitting
Now and then will not re-start after driving.
Let the car sit >30 min and fire's up in 1-2 sec
Noticed mainly during 'Hot / High Sun Exposure',
But today after morning drive for 12 min would not re-start (temp 30F) until it sat for > 30 min. Then restarted fine and within 1-2 sec of cranking. And re-started, restarted, ... atleast 10 trys no further problems
To-Do:
Have searched the HAF and will double check Fuel Cap, Fuel Pump & Relays
Also will check Plugs, Coil, Dist caps, .. the simple basic stuff
Take to Parts House for Fault Code Check
But did notice 1 thing from under-hood check
the IAT Sensor is 'Wet' fairly clean looking oil, will spend some time to check the threads / seal or sensor cracked.
Any other focus Debugging Steps would be appreciated
